❓ Question

Balance the equation by ion-electron method:

Zn+NO3Zn2++NH4+Zn + NO_3^- \rightarrow Zn^{2+} + NH_4^+

(in basic medium)


đź–Ľ Question Image

Zn and Nitrate Reaction Ion Electron Method


✍️ Short Explanation

This is a redox balancing problem in basic medium.

👉 Zinc gets oxidised
👉 Nitrate gets reduced
👉 Use ion-electron method carefully.


đź”· Step 1 — Identify Oxidation and Reduction đź’Ż

Oxidation half reaction:

ZnZn2+Zn \rightarrow Zn^{2+}

Reduction half reaction:

NO3NH4+NO_3^- \rightarrow NH_4^+

Oxidation states of nitrogen:

+53+5 \rightarrow -3

So nitrogen gains:

8e8e^-

đź”· Step 2 — Oxidation Half Reaction

Balance charge:

ZnZn2++2eZn \rightarrow Zn^{2+}+2e^-

đź”· Step 3 — Reduction Half Reaction

Start with:

NO3NH4+NO_3^- \rightarrow NH_4^+

Balance oxygen using water:

NO3NH4++3H2ONO_3^- \rightarrow NH_4^+ +3H_2O

Balance hydrogen using:

10H+10H^+
10H++NO3NH4++3H2O10H^+ +NO_3^- \rightarrow NH_4^+ +3H_2O

Balance charge using electrons:

8e+10H++NO3NH4++3H2O8e^- +10H^+ +NO_3^- \rightarrow NH_4^+ +3H_2O

đź”· Step 4 — Convert into Basic Medium

Add:

10OH10OH^-

on both sides:

8e+10H++10OH+NO3NH4++3H2O+10OH8e^- +10H^+ +10OH^- +NO_3^- \rightarrow NH_4^+ +3H_2O+10OH^-

Since:

H++OH=H2OH^+ +OH^- = H_2O
8e+10H2O+NO3NH4++3H2O+10OH8e^- +10H_2O +NO_3^- \rightarrow NH_4^+ +3H_2O+10OH^-

Cancel water:

8e+7H2O+NO3NH4++10OH8e^- +7H_2O +NO_3^- \rightarrow NH_4^+ +10OH^-

đź”· Step 5 — Equalise Electrons

Oxidation reaction:

ZnZn2++2eZn \rightarrow Zn^{2+}+2e^-

Multiply by 4:

4Zn4Zn2++8e4Zn \rightarrow 4Zn^{2+}+8e^-

Add both half reactions:

4Zn+7H2O+NO34Zn2++NH4++10OH4Zn +7H_2O +NO_3^- \rightarrow 4Zn^{2+}+NH_4^+ +10OH^-

✅ Final Answer

4Zn+7H2O+NO34Zn2++NH4++10OH\boxed{ 4Zn +7H_2O +NO_3^- \rightarrow 4Zn^{2+}+NH_4^+ +10OH^- }
